HEAD for the Hills has joined the fight against gender inequality in the music industry.
The Ramsbottom music festival has partnered up with the PRS Foundation's Keychange pledge joining dozens of other events around the world in pledging to maintaining a 50/50 gender balance across their events by 2022.
David Agnew, Festival Director, Head For The Hills comments: "Head For The Hills is proud to join the Keychange pledge recognising the value of a diverse programme in exciting audiences and improving our festival. Our commitment to creating a welcoming and open environment permeates the organisation from our trustees to our audiences, which is only possible with a programme which reflects our immediate communities."
Head for the Hills returns to Ramsbottom Cricket Club on September 14, 15 and 16, with headliners The Boomtown Rats, The Bluetones, The Beat and the Selector.
